Understanding the Integumentary System



The integumentary system is the body's largest organ system and serves multiple functions. To appreciate its complexity, it's important to break it down into its primary components and roles.

Components of the Integumentary System



The integumentary system consists of several parts, each contributing to its overall function:


  • Skin: The outermost layer, which includes the epidermis, dermis, and subcutaneous tissue.

  • Hair: Provides insulation and protection, as well as sensitivity to touch.

  • Nails: Protect the distal phalanx and enhance fine motor skills.

  • Glands: Include sweat glands and sebaceous glands, which help in temperature regulation and lubrication.



Functions of the Integumentary System



The integumentary system performs several vital functions:

1. Protection: Acts as a physical barrier against pathogens, harmful chemicals, and physical damage.
2. Temperature Regulation: Maintains body temperature through sweat production and blood flow regulation.
3. Sensory Perception: Contains nerve endings that detect touch, pressure, pain, and temperature.
4. Vitamin D Synthesis: Facilitates the production of vitamin D when exposed to sunlight, which is essential for calcium absorption.
5. Excretion: Assists in the removal of waste products through sweat.

Key Terms in Integumentary System Study



Familiarizing yourself with key terms will enhance your understanding and retention of the subject matter. Below are some important terms related to the integumentary system:


  • Epidermis: The outer layer of skin, primarily composed of keratinized cells.

  • Dermis: The thicker layer beneath the epidermis, containing connective tissue, hair follicles, and glands.

  • Subcutaneous Layer: Also known as hypodermis, it consists of fat and connective tissues that insulate the body.

  • Keratinocytes: The primary cell type found in the epidermis, responsible for producing keratin.

  • Melanocytes: Cells that produce melanin, contributing to skin pigmentation.

Common Disorders of the Integumentary System



Understanding common disorders can enhance your knowledge of the integumentary system's functions and vulnerabilities. Here are a few prevalent conditions:


  • Psoriasis: A chronic autoimmune condition that leads to the rapid growth of skin cells, resulting in scaling and inflammation.

  • Eczema: A condition characterized by itchy, inflamed skin, often triggered by allergens or irritants.

  • Dermatitis: Inflammation of the skin, which can be caused by contact with allergens or irritants.

  • Skin Cancer: Abnormal growth of skin cells, often due to excessive sun exposure; includes types like melanoma, basal cell carcinoma, and squamous cell carcinoma.

Frequently Asked Questions


What are the primary functions of the integumentary system?

The primary functions of the integumentary system include protection, regulation of body temperature, sensory perception, and synthesis of vitamin D.

What are the main layers of the skin?

The main layers of the skin are the epidermis, dermis, and subcutaneous tissue (hypodermis).

What type of cells are primarily found in the epidermis?

The epidermis primarily contains keratinocytes, but also includes melanocytes, Langerhans cells, and Merkel cells.

How does the integumentary system contribute to homeostasis?

The integumentary system helps maintain homeostasis by regulating temperature through sweat production and blood flow, as well as protecting against environmental hazards.

What is the role of melanin in the skin?

Melanin provides pigmentation to the skin and helps protect against ultraviolet (UV) radiation by absorbing and dissipating UV rays.

What are the common disorders of the integumentary system?

Common disorders include acne, eczema, psoriasis, dermatitis, and skin cancer.

What is the significance of sebaceous glands in the skin?

Sebaceous glands produce sebum, which lubricates the skin and hair, and helps prevent bacterial growth.

How does the integumentary system interact with the immune system?

The integumentary system acts as a barrier to pathogens and contains immune cells, such as Langerhans cells, which help detect and fight infections.

What are the differences between first, second, and third-degree burns?

First-degree burns affect only the epidermis (redness and pain), second-degree burns affect both the epidermis and dermis (blisters and swelling), and third-degree burns extend through the skin to underlying tissues (charred or white skin, numbness).
